Particulars of Sale

Under Pendle House

Barley | Lancashire | BB9 6LQ

£595,000 Reduced from £650,000

A distinctive detached period house situated in a spectacular elevated position with surrounding panoramic open views. The property has great style and character and has been significantly extended and improved to form a superb family house with high quality fitments and immaculate decor.
